Summary

Involved in negative regulation of transcription by RNA polymerase II. Located in nucleus.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Jul 2025]

Forensic Context

The long non-coding RNA PINT is identified as a biomarker detected in the blood and peripheral blood mononuclear cells (PBMCs) of human schizophrenia patients [Das et al. DOI:10.1080/21655979.2021.2003667].
